Determine whether maximal-shattering numbers are non-decreasing

Determine whether the sequence (s_k(X,S))_{k∈N} is non-decreasing for every set system (X,S) with finite VC-dimension.

Background

The maximal-shattering sequence s_k(X,S) counts the isomorphism types of subsets of maximum size that are shattered by the k-fold union of a set system S. Although the sequence of corresponding VC-dimensions is non-decreasing because S is contained in each k-fold union, the paper notes that monotonicity of the number of isomorphism types does not follow from this observation. The authors explicitly ask whether the maximal-shattering sequence must nevertheless be non-decreasing for every finite-VC set system.
